将QT “.ui "文件转换为. py "文件,然后调用资源引用将. ui文件转换为. py文件
python使用Qt接口和逻辑实现
准备在环境中安装打包工具:
pip install pyinstalle安装PyQt5:
pip install PyQt5安装PyQt5工具:
对于pip install PyQt5-tools,建议使用自定义安装路径。
pipinstallpyqt5- tools-I http://pypi.douban.com/simple-- trusted-host=pypi.douban.com开始1、打开界面生成软件"designer.exe"
2、新建一个窗口
3、界面任意添加一些控件
4、保存以上生成的界面为".ui"文件
5、将".ui"文件转换为".py"文件
在. ui文件目录中打开cmd窗口并输入命令。 pyuic5 -o文件名. py文件名. ui
6、python调用QT界面文件
创建新的. python文件
添加importsysfrompyqt5. qtwidgetsimportqapplication、qmainwindowfrompyqt5. qtcoreimportqobject #接口文件, 此处的文件名为lock _ ui.pyfrom lock _ ui import * class main window (qmainwindow ) 3360 def _ init _ (self ) : super )
pyinstaller -F -w filename.py打包的可执行文件位于当前目录的dist文件夹下
关于打包问题,请参照以下内容。
Python如何将项目打包为exe可执行文件